Make BOS a complete, bootable, themed desktop OS

Install/boot reliability:
- Use native Calamares initcpiocfg/initcpio + explicit grub-install (nvram +
  --removable) in post-install; drop the flaky native bootloader/grubcfg modules.
- mount.conf: bind /proc /sys /dev (devtmpfs) /run + efivars into the chroot.
- bos-copy-kernel: stage kernel + write a stock mkinitcpio preset (replace the
  archiso preset). Per-service systemctl enable (fixes NetworkManager et al.
  silently not enabling due to the all-or-nothing grub-btrfs.path name).

System completeness:
- greetd + tuigreet graphical login; installed pacman.conf + working mirrorlist;
  base CLI tools (nano, micro, vim, htop, …); amd/intel-ucode; tlp + hypridle
  power management; systemd-timesyncd, fstrim.timer; wpa_supplicant wifi; Zen
  browser (republished to the [Breadway] repo).

Desktop + theming:
- Native Lua Hyprland config (hyprland.lua) with curated standard binds; kitty
  (blur) replaces foot; awww wallpaper + pywal palette (tamed to a black base
  with warm accents); GTK dark mode.
- Plymouth boot splash (bos theme: logo + spinner + status) via plymouthcfg.
- Varela Round font; Calamares bread-palette sidebar (logo/black-region polish
  still pending).

# -----------------------------------------------------------------------
# Breadway custom repo — provides: bakery and the bread ecosystem packages
# (bread, breadbar, breadbox, breadcrumbs, breadpad, bos-settings).
# (calamares comes from the official extra repo, not here.)
#
# Packages are published to the Forgejo Arch registry (group "os") by the
# .forgejo/workflows/package.yml workflow in each repo, on tag push.
#
# Forgejo signs the repo db with a key pacman can't look up, so TrustAll
# fails. SigLevel = Never skips verification (acceptable for this private
# repo over TLS). TODO: import Forgejo's signing key + SigLevel = Required.
# -----------------------------------------------------------------------
# The section name must match Forgejo's served db filename
# ({owner}.{group}.{domain}.db) — pacman fetches "<section>.db" from Server.
[Breadway.os.git.breadway.dev]
SigLevel = Never
Server = https://git.breadway.dev/api/packages/Breadway/arch/os/$arch
